Tender Encrusted Baked Pork Chops
I love pork chops. I also like the concept behind breaded meats. I had never tried to combine them before, but they turned out great! The quick cooking on either side really helped to retain the moisture of the pork chops while they baked in the oven. I’d highly recommend these! Just give them a try, you won’t regret it. ![]() Yield: 6 servings | Prep time: 0:15 | Cook time: 1:00 | Total time (est.): 1:15 Ingredients for Tender Encrusted Baked Pork Chops: 6 pork chops 1 teaspoon garlic powder 1 teaspoon seasoning salt 2 eggs, beaten 1/4 cup all-purpose flour 2 cups Italian style breadcrumbs 4 tablespoons olive oil Directions: Preheat oven to 350. Rinse pork chops, pat dry, and season with garlic powder and seasoning salt to taste. Place the beaten eggs in a small bowl. Dredge the pork chops lightly in flour, dip in the egg, and coat liberally with bread crumbs. Heat the oil in a medium skillet over medium-high heat. Fry the pork chops 5 minutes per side, or until the breading appears well browned. Transfer the chops to a 9 x 13 baking dish, and cover with foil. Bake in the preheated oven for 1 hour, or until cooked through. Enjoy!
